I care a lot more about AP/FSD features than games or gimmicks. Having said, I think we need to remember a few things:
1) Updates can include changes that are not mentioned in the release notes. V10 most likely includes AP improvements not listed in the release notes.
2) The new driver visualizations imply that V10 has a bigger NN. And we know of features such as enhanced summon, traffic light detection and smart park that are coming in future V10 updates. So V10 will give us AP/FSD improvements and features.
4) It is not an either or proposition. Updates can include both games and improvements to AP. The presence of a few games or "gimmicks" does not mean that Tesla cannot also add AP improvements.
5) The games and other miscellaneous features like theater mode, Joe mode and hungry mode do add some value. They do serve a purpose. They will enhance enjoyment for some owners. For example, I could see a family on a long trip having fun with the karaoke. Maybe a couple on a date, find a nice spot to park and uses theater mode to watch a romantic movie together. If these features can improve the experience for some owners, that's a plus. We should not dismiss that just because we personally don't care about the features. Someone else might like the features!

What is the "typical" flow time from EAP release to wide public release of major Tesla software updates? It seems like Tesla would need time to incorporate code fixes based on EAP feedback and results.

There are 2 Early Access levels levels that are public facing, but a few more that are not. Much like the ring system that Microsoft uses.

First release is to engineers. Then a group of internal testers. Then NDA's. Then we start moving to more public early access folks.

Builds are usually around 4 weeks from first compile to release but some have been as little as 2 weeks and some have taken longer. It all really depends on how the internal tests go.

Once you see it on something like Telsafi you will typically get it in one to two weeks provided it is a public build and no issues were found.

Hope that helps a little. Software is always kind of a moving target. You can never really put a date on anything.
